Framework
Four acts. Ten moves. One lifecycle.
Manipulation mechanisms (M)
Disarm
M1
Sycophantic Affirmation
Systematically affirms the user even when clearly wrong; sustained validation erodes critical thinking and reality-testing.
M2
False Intimacy
Claims of feeling or consciousness plus premature intimacy create an asymmetric bond — the hook of the affective-capture family.
Distort
M3
Epistemic Manipulation
Takes over the user's picture of reality: selective framing, false authority, gaslighting — judgment outsourced to the system.
M4
Subliminal Embedding
Implants preferences or conclusions below the user's awareness threshold — influence that never presents itself as influence.
M5
Decision Distortion
Steers choices through framing, defaults, urgency and option pruning until the decision serves the system's goal, not the user's.
Detain
M6
Information Asymmetry Exploitation
Uses multi-turn informational advantage and intimacy to extract excess data or withhold key information.
M7
Emotional Coercion
Never says "you can't leave" — makes leaving feel like loss or betrayal. Guilt and FOMO as exit friction.
M8
Trauma Bonding & Dependency
Cultivates "can't live without it": prolonged sessions, variable reward, capability erosion; the AI becomes the primary comfort source.
M9
Isolation
The unconditional-acceptance trap: positions the AI as the only stable relationship, weakens help-seeking, severs external support.
Deflect
M10
Fake Accountability
Apologises without changing; dissolves accountability via "just a model / for reference only". A defensive layer triggered on challenge.

User-harm chain (H)
H1
Vulnerability exploitation
The system latches onto loneliness, grief, low defences, psychological fragility — the starting point of most harm.
H2
Cognitive / judgment impairment
Accommodation and amplification gradually build the narrative "this is who I am" / "only it understands me".
H3
Emotional distress
Anxiety, shame, fear, anger, insomnia begin to appear — before any extreme behaviour.
H4
Dependency
Returns to the AI frequently; treats it as the primary source of comfort, advice, relationship.
H5
Unsafe relational displacement
The AI crowds out family, friends, colleagues, therapists — the deepening stage of dependency.
H6
Harmful decision / Manipulation
Induced, pressured, retained, pushed — ultimately a decision against the user's own interest.
H7
Functional loss
Work, study, self-care and real-world functioning degrade as the relationship consumes capacity.
H8
Privacy/Reputation harm
Over-disclosed intimate data leaks, is monetised, or is weaponised — harm that outlives the conversation.
H9
Self-harm
The terminal, highest-severity end: self-harm, suicide induction, crisis-referral failure.
H10
Developmental harm
(Minors) curiosity, exploration, self-efficacy and future trajectory suppressed; the most heavily litigated class.
H11

Amplifiers (A)
A1
Subjectivity Leverage
The system's real or apparent subjectivity weaponises user empathy ("I care about you"). Raises impact alongside M2/M7/M8.
A2
Commercial Agenda
Manipulation amplified when optimisation serves provider revenue — engagement, retention, monetisation. Enters the risk formula as a multiplier.
